I AM – One of many, many of One

A poetic reflection of memory loss unpacked through an Afro-Futuristic lens.

Winner of the Most Memorable Show, Lustrum Award 2023. Part of the modular series I AM.

A first-generation immigrant straddles her Habesha (Eritrean/Ethiopian) heritage and British identity only to realise, when you leave everything behind for the promise of something better, it’s not "better". A poetic reflection on memory loss, displacement, tradition and survival, interwoven with language, customs, music and wearable tech MiMu gloves (as used by Imogen Heap).

Neither a musical, nor drama: a new kind of storytelling.

Outstanding Performance nominee Filipa Bragança Award, 2023.
